Here's a clear, step-by-step explanation of how the **card business works end-to-end**, covering the entire lifecycle of payment cards \u2014 from issuance to transaction processing and settlement:\n\n---\n\n## End-to-End Card Business: How It Works\n\n### 1. Card Issuance\n- **Client onboarding:** A financial institution (bank or credit union) or fintech partners with a card service provider like Fiserv to issue payment cards to customers.\n- **Card production:** The provider personalizes physical cards (printing cardholder info, embedding EMV chip, encoding magnetic stripe) or creates virtual cards for digital wallets.\n- **Account linkage:** Each card is linked to the cardholder\u2019s account for tracking balances, credit limits, and transactions.\n- **Activation:** Cardholders activate their cards, enabling use for transactions.\n\n### 2. Cardholder Makes a Payment\n- Cardholders use their cards to pay at merchants, online or in-store, using swipe, chip, contactless (NFC), or mobile wallet methods.\n- The merchant captures payment details via a Point of Sale (POS) terminal or payment gateway.\n\n### 3. Authorization\n- The merchant\u2019s acquiring bank or payment processor sends the transaction details to the card network (Visa, Mastercard, etc.).\n- The card network routes the authorization request to the card issuer.\n- The issuer verifies card validity, sufficient funds or credit, and fraud indicators.\n- Issuer sends an approval or decline message back through the network to the acquirer, then to the merchant\u2019s terminal \u2014 typically in seconds.\n\n### 4. Clearing and Settlement\n- After authorization, transaction details are forwarded for clearing, where fees and transaction data are calculated.\n- Settlement moves the funds from the cardholder\u2019s bank (issuer) to the merchant\u2019s bank (acquirer), deducting interchange and processing fees.\n- This process usually takes 1-3 business days, depending on networks and banks involved.\n\n### 5. Transaction Posting and Statements\n- Issuers post the transaction to cardholder accounts, updating balances or credit.\n- Cardholders receive monthly statements that include all card activity, including payments, fees, and interest (if applicable).\n\n### 6. Risk Management and Fraud Detection\n- Throughout this process, continuous real-time monitoring checks for anomalies or fraudulent activities.\n- Systems use machine learning, behavioral analytics, and rules-based filters to flag suspicious transactions.\n- When fraud occurs, chargebacks and dispute resolution mechanisms protect cardholders and merchants.\n\n### 7. Reporting and Analytics\n- Financial institutions and merchants receive detailed reports on transaction volumes, revenues, chargebacks, and customer behavior.\n- Analytics help optimize card usage, risk strategies, and marketing campaigns.\n\n### 8. Customer Support & Maintenance\n- Ongoing support includes handling lost/stolen cards, card renewals, dispute management, and compliance with regulatory requirements.\n- Enhancements like digital wallets, instant issuance, and value-added services improve user experience.\n\n---\n\n### Key Infrastructure and Stakeholders:\n- **Issuer:** Bank or financial institution issuing the card.\n- **Cardholder:** Consumer or business using the card.\n- **Merchant:** Business accepting card payments.\n- **Acquirer:** Merchant\u2019s bank facilitating payment acceptance.\n- **Card Network:** Visa, Mastercard, etc., that route transactions.\n- **Processor:** Technology provider (like Fiserv) enabling authorization, clearing, and settlement.\n\n---\n\n### Summary\nThe card business orchestrates complex interactions among banks, merchants, networks, and technology providers to enable secure, fast, and reliable electronic payments. It combines physical/virtual card issuance, authorization, clearing, settlement, risk management, and support services into an integrated ecosystem that sustains global commerce.\n\n---\n\nIf you'd like, I can also create a detailed flowchart or dive into any individual step to explore the technology and processes further!","behavior":"degenerate_repetition","conversation_hash":"0c1e71d6b0651cb3be835106dd2fc97e","conversation_redacted":false,"conversation_toxic":false,"country":"United Kingdom","empty_output":false,"evidence_codes":[],"label":"absent","label_present":false,"label_qualified":false,"label_source":"Final dense release","language":"English","model":"gpt-4.1-mini-2025-04-14","n_chars":4099,"n_turns_in_conversation":8,"n_words":573,"source_row_offset":3783,"source_shard":"turns-00069.parquet","timestamp":"Fri, 18 Apr 2025 09:35:38 GMT","turn_id":"8027526738026ed13e169d03","turn_index":7,"user_text":"nice, but want to learn how card business works end to end"},{"assistant_initiates":false,"asst_text":"To update your frontend (`EmployeeReferralPortal.jsx`) and backend (`app.py`) code so that the following fields are **removed** entirely:\n\n- `jobCode`\n- `collegeName`\n- `collegeCity`\n- `rejectionReason`\n\nand to make the fields:\n\n- `applyingFor`\n- `resume`\n\n**optional** instead of required, follow these steps:\n\n---\n\n### 1. \u043f\u0443\u0430\u0441\u0441\u043e\u043d\u043e\u0432\u0441\u043a\u0438\u0439 \u043f\u0440\u043e\u0446\u0435\u0441\u0441"},{"assistant_initiates":false,"asst_text":"The format specifier `%08llu` used in `snprintf` (or `printf`-style functions) can be broken down as follows:\n\n- `%`: Start of the format specifier.\n- `0`: Flag that specifies to pad the output with zeros instead of spaces.\n- `8`: Minimum field width. The output will be at least 8 characters wide.\n- `ll`: Length modifier indicating the argument is of type `long long` (typically a 64-bit integer).\n- `u`: Conversion specifier for unsigned decimal integer.\n\n### What It Does:\n\nIt formats an **unsigned long long integer** (`unsigned long long int`) to produce a string of at least 8 characters wide, padding with leading zeros if the number has fewer digits.\n\n### Example:\n\n```c\n#include <stdio.h>\n\nint main() {\n    unsigned long long num = 12345;\n    char buffer[20];\n\n    snprintf(buffer, sizeof(buffer), \"%08llu\", num);\n    printf(\"Formatted number: %s\\n\", buffer);\n\n    return 0;\n}\n```\n\n**Output:**\n\n```\nFormatted number: 00012345\n```\n\nIf `num` were larger than 8 digits, the width would expand accordingly (minimum width), but no truncation happens.\n\n### Summary\n\n- `%08llu` means: print an unsigned long long integer, minimum width 8, pad with leading zeros if necessary.\n\nLet me know if you'd like more examples!","behavior":"degenerate_repetition","conversation_hash":"4145ed18f6b70ff7241a7c0d928e23f9","conversation_redacted":false,"conversation_toxic":false,"country":"Poland","empty_output":false,"evidence_codes":[],"label":"absent","label_present":false,"label_qualified":false,"label_source":"Final dense release","language":"English","model":"gpt-4.1-mini-2025-04-14","n_chars":1253,"n_turns_in_conversation":1,"n_words":195,"source_row_offset":3786,"source_shard":"turns-00069.parquet","timestamp":"Fri, 18 Apr 2025 09:37:20 GMT","turn_id":"d12b1efebf9408a4db9c97ed","turn_index":0,"user_text":"what this %08llu snprint format "},{"assistant_initiates":false,"asst_text":"Rendite ist der Gewinn, den man aus einer Geldanlage erh\u00e4lt.
